Transaction 393575094b67d76c7197e49928f25afa1eb0bde5d9407b1ea38cf430b08f5a60
1 Input
1 Output
-
393575094b67d76c7197e49928f25afa1eb0bde5d9407b1ea38cf430b08f5a60:0
- value
- 1037135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5f257c05ad2d94e3497dc58b9df13c348e280d4 OP_EQUAL
- address
- 3GpTjU44FEHc81XDmDYsPz4PegPEkHizxx